MORGANTON - Jack Greene, 62, of Grandview Avenue, died Feb. 1, 2000 at Grace Hos-
pital. Born July 17, 1937, in Yancey County, he was a son of the late Lewis and Hattie
Gurley Greene.

A member of Boonford Baptist Church in Yancey County, he retired from Drexel-Heritage
Furnishings.

Survivors include his wife, Addie Mae McFarland Greene; a son, Jackie Lee Green of Mor-
ganton; a daughter, Janice Greene Stone of Morganton; two brothers, Bobby Greene and
Charles Greene of Ellenboro; three sisters, Faye Hughes of Burnsville, Mae Willis of Spruce
Pine and MIldred Boons of Bakersville; and five grandchildren.

The funeral service will be conducted by the Revs. Billy Mitchel and Dean Lavender at 11 a.m.
Thursday at Sossoman Funeral Home. Burial will be in the Gus Young Cemetery in Burns-
ville at 2 p.m. Thursday.

The family will be at the funeral home from 7 to 8:30 tonight and at the residence, 213 Grand-
view Avenue, all other times.

[Hickory Daily Record, Wednesday, February 2, 2000]
